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
12330 53044438 75313
1316 51 622130045
1316 51 622130045
43188069361 960685664 86 570
All about undefined
Interested in learning more?
1316 51 622130045
43188069361 960685664 86 570
See more
3185 2532915283 108
4310381858 69561 333173239
See more
939465369 108757 26270
7895898297 5199771 4023086
See more